Output 99983830d555f2b366db41cc564242f3e083624bdcf1a8401cbec3e4a5dcbd0a:1
- value
- 27678294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ebeb135fa050e22c3bc94fc897c35c83ad84e18f OP_EQUAL
- address
- 3PCSKy7mPejajugXZU5aqVswv7Rm8EPCyE
- transaction
- 99983830d555f2b366db41cc564242f3e083624bdcf1a8401cbec3e4a5dcbd0a
- confirmations
- 524258
- spent
- true